第494章 幻数据压缩算法猜想

作者:纯白色科幻宅 加入书签推荐本书

0101010a

1010100b

1011010c

0100100d

1001010被注册表定义为大于a,小于b;3个1,4个0;

0010000被注册表定义为小于d;1个1,6个0;

1100011被注册表定义为大于c;4个1,3个0;

0111011被注册表定义为大于a,小于b;5个1,2个0;

1011110被注册表定义为大于c;5个1,2个0;

1110111被注册表定义为大于c;6个1,1个0;

0111011被注册表定义为大于a,小于b;5个1,2个0;

1011101被注册表定义为大于c;5个1,2个0;

1101110被注册表定义为大于c;5个1,2个0;

1110111被注册表定义为大于c;6个1,1个0;

0111011被注册表定义为大于a,小于b;5个1,2个0;

1011010被注册表定义为等于c;4个1,3个0;

0100111被注册表定义为大于d,小于a;4个1,3个0;

[示例完毕]

为了节省篇幅,以及避免作者使用自然人脑来进行比大小这种运算,而且使用的还是二进制,为了避免麻烦和出错,也就没有使用什么三百位的二进制作为注册表,然而计算机完全可以通过这套算法,生成1kb大小的比大小筛选注册表,从而加速解压缩速度,以及碰撞速度。

当然了,如果是使用1gb大小的比大小筛选注册表,就可以用于zb级别的数据快速解压缩了。

使用循环规则,把一个数控制在尽可能小的范围内,然后使用各种进制的转换,来逆推出其原本是什么数,减少运算次数同时,也加快解压缩速度;减少了大量的无用但必须的运算(试错运算)。

上一页 返回目录 下一页